Building Access — Cleaning Crew (Hollyoak Site)

The Bramblewise cleaning crew comes in weeknights between 19:00 and 23:00, plus Saturday mornings for the deep clean of the Tarn Floor kitchens. They don't carry permanent badges — long story involving the old Keppler system — so they sign in at the facilities desk and get a day fob. If the desk is unstaffed, the crew supervisor lets themselves in through the service door by the bins, which runs on the shared contractor code below.

turnstile pass: bdg-EVG-1

Key ceremony checklist — item 7 (Gridwright crossword generator)

New folks: Gridwright's clue-bank signing key lives in the ceremony safe, not in CI. Before the ceremony: confirm two witnesses present, laptop offline, camera off. Verify the puzzle-seed archive checksum matches the printed sheet. Initial the log. Do not proceed if any step fails. Once the safe is open, unseal the clue-bank volume using the recovery passphrase printed below.

unlock words, hahip-baduf: holwyn-istath-julvan

**TICKET-981: PickPath optimizer using wrong zone map**

PickPath at the Dorvane warehouse is optimizing against last month's zone layout, so pick lists route people into the decommissioned aisle. Root cause: `optimizer.env` on the edge node still points at the old map bucket. Update `ZONE_MAP_URI` and restart. The bucket requires auth; the access credential belongs on the next line.

env line for baduf-hahog: RELAY_SECRET3=c4a